WebOct 4, 2024 · Nucleotide Definition. A nucleotide is an organic molecule that is the building block of DNA and RNA. They also have functions related to cell signaling, metabolism, and enzyme reactions. A nucleotide is made up of three parts: a phosphate group, a 5-carbon sugar, and a nitrogenous base. WebIn contrast, the bond between a phosphoryl group and Adenosine is much lower in energy. These reactions: ATP + H₂0 → ADP + Pᵢ. ADP + H₂0 → AMP + Pᵢ. yield more than twice the energy compared to this reaction: AMP + H₂0 → Adenosine + Pᵢ. So, yes the additional phosphates result in higher energy bonds. Comment. WebFeb 14, 2024 · Phase 1: The "Priming Step". The first phase of Glycolysis requires an input of energy in the form of ATP (adenosine triphosphate). alpha-D- Glucose is phosphorolated at the 6 carbon by ATP via the enzyme Hexokinase (Class: Transferase) to yield alpha-D-Glucose-6-phosphate (G-6-P).
